Dear Matt:
Attached is a draft ordinance in response to Assembly's request to address teleconferencing.
This ordinance would allow attendance by Assembly members via teleconference ONLY during
work sessions and emergency meetings and prohibit the practice during regular or special
meetings. This was discussed at the last work session by the Assembly and the agreement was
to have you review the attached ordinance for legality since AS 44.62.310 currently allows
attendance and participation at meetings by members of the public or by members of a
governmental body by teleconferencing.
I also included wording to allow participation in the event of an emergency meeting and the
provisions as set in AS 44.62.310 will be followed.

AN ORDINANCE OF THE KODIAK ISLAND BOROUGH
AMENDING KODIAK ISLAND BOROUGH CODE OF ORDINANCES
TITLE 2 ADMINISTRATION AND PERSONNEL, CHAPTER 2.17 RULES OF THE ASSEMBL
SECTION 2.17.020 GENERAL RULES TO PROHIBIT ASSEMBLY MEMBER ATTENDANCE
AT REGULAR AND SPECIAL MEETINGS BY TELECONFERENCE r���(
AND ALLOW IT ONLY DURING WORK SESSIONS to ��1 eR,61 e ;� " Aj
WHEREAS, Alaska Statute 44.62.310 states "attendance and participation at meetings by
members of the public or by members of a governmental body may be by teleconferencing;" and
WHEREAS, Assembly members who attend by teleconference may not be able to communicate
as well with other Assembly members, the public, and the administration as could someone in
attendance;
WHEREAS, decisions made regarding public policy are best made in person, rather than by
telephone; and
WHEREAS, the Assembly desires to establish a policy to allow attendance by teleconference of
Assembly members only during work sessions and emergency meeting; and
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T ORDAINED BY THE ASSEMBLY OF THE KODIAK ISLAND
BOROUGH THAT:
Section 1: This ordinance is of a general and permanent nature and shall become a part of the
Kodiak Island Borough Code of Ordinances.
Section 2: Title 2 Administration and Personnel Chapter 2.17 Rules of the Assembly Section
2.17.020 General Rules is hereby amended as follows:
2.17.020 General rules.
A. Public meetings: All official meetings of the assembly shall be open to the public. The
journal of proceedings shall be open to public inspection.
B. Quorum: Four (4) members of the assembly shall constitute a quorum. Attendance of
assembly members shall be in person and may not be by teleconference, except for work sessions
and emergency meetings. In the event of an emergency meeting, the provisions set in AS44.62.310
shall be followed.
C. Absences: No member of the assembly may absent himself from any regular or
special meeting of the assembly except for good cause. An assembly member who is unable to
attend a meeting shall advise the clerk or the mayor of the contemplated absence and the reason
for that absence. During the course of the meeting from which the member is absent, the chair shall
cause the record to reflect the absence of the member, the reason for the absence and whether the
absence is excused by the assembly.
D. Rules of order: 'Roberts Rules of Order Current Edition" shall govern the
proceedings of the assembly in all cases, unless they are in conflict with these rules. When such a
conflict exists, this ordinance prevails.

Sec. 44.62.310. Government meetings public.
(a) All meetings of a governmental body of a public entity of the state are open to the public except as otherwise
provided by this section or another provision of law. Attendance and participation at meetings by members of the
public or by members of a governmental body may be by NteleconferencingH. Agency materials that are to be
considered at the meeting shall be made available at teleconference locations if practicable. Except when voice votes
are authorized, the vote shall be conducted in such a manner that the public may know the vote of each person entitled
to vote. The vote at a meeting held by teleconference shall be taken by roll call. This section does not apply to any
votes required to be taken to organize a governmental body described in this subsection.
(b) If permitted subjects are to be discussed at a meeting in executive session, the meeting must first be convened
as a public meeting and the question of holding an executive session to discuss matters that are listed in (c) of this
section shall be determined by a majority vote of the governmental body. The motion to convene in executive session
must clearly and with specificity describe the subject of the proposed executive session without defeating the purpose
of addressing the subject in private. Subjects may not be considered at the executive session except those mentioned in
the motion calling for the executive session unless auxiliary to the main question. Action may not be taken at an
executive session, except to give direction to an attorney or labor negotiator regarding the handling of a specific legal
matter or pending labor negotiations.
(c) The following subjects may be considered in an executive session:
(1) matters, the immediate knowledge of which would clearly have an adverse effect upon the finances of the
public entity;
(2) subjects that tend to prejudice the reputation and character of any person, provided the person may request a
public discussion;
(3) matters which by law, municipal charter, or ordinance are required to be confidential;
(4) matters involving consideration of government records that by law are not subject to public disclosure.
(d) This section does not apply to
(1) a governmental body performing a judicial or quasi - judicial function when holding a meeting solely to make a
decision in an adjudicatory proceeding;
(2) juries;
(3) parole or pardon boards;
(4) meetings of a hospital medical staff;
(5) meetings of the governmental body or any committee of a hospital when holding a meeting solely to act upon
matters of professional qualifications, privileges or discipline;
(6) staff meetings or other gatherings of the employees of a public entity, including meetings of an employee
group established by policy of the Board of Regents of the University of Alaska or held while acting in an advisory
capacity to the Board of Regents; or
(7) meetings held for the purpose of participating in or attending a gathering of a national, state, or regional
organization of which the public entity, governmental body, or member of the governmental body is a member, but
only if no action is taken and no business of the governmental body is conducted at the meetings.
